The overview below groups typical Structural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bedford,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method used. For example, minor cracks might cost around $2,000, while extensive underpinning could reach $10,000 or more.
Pier and Beam Repairs - Repair costs for pier and beam foundations generally fall between $1,500 and $5,000. This includes lifting and stabilizing the structure, with larger projects potentially exceeding $7,000 based on size and complexity.
Wall and Crack Reinforcement - Reinforcing or sealing foundation cracks typically costs between $500 and $2,500. The price varies with crack size, location, and whether additional structural work is necessary.
Basement Foundation Fixes - Addressing basement foundation issues can range from $3,000 to $15,000, depending on the severity of settlement or water intrusion problems. Larger or more complex repairs tend to be on the higher end of this spectrum.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and gaps around door frames.
How do professionals typically repair foundation problems? Repair methods can involve under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ization, depending on the specific issue and foundation type.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Not all cracks require repair; a professional evaluation can determine if repairs are needed based on crack size, location, and severity.
How long does a typical foundation repair process take? The duration varies based on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few days to a week.
